Robert's obituary
Robert Anthony Duca, 73, died February 15th after a long respiratory illness with his brother and sister by his side. Born and raised in Worcester, MA, Bob had a strong character and fiercely independent soul. He joined The United States Coast Guard at 18 and served in Alaska for 3 years. For years Bob worked in the trades, also working for Job Corp. in Grafton Ma. before moving to Vermont where he was employed by Leader Distribution Systems (Pepsi) until his retirement.
He was a celebrated figure, hailing passers-by and feeding friends and neighbors from his massive vegetable garden. Bob was an outdoor enthusiast, His dry wit, intelligence, and generous nature made him a good friend, though he was equally ready to help complete strangers in a moment’s notice.
He leaves behind a daughter, Anna Mae Huguenen & husband Dennis of Halifax, a son, James Duca, of Bellows Falls, a sister Ann-Marie Sarja and her husband Ron, of Palm Beach Gardens, FL, a brother, Steven Duca, and his wife Robin, of Delray Beach, FL, a sister-in-law Sylvia Duca of Tomball, TX, a very dear friend Adrian Stockwell of Putney, VT, and many nieces and nephews. He was predeceased by his older brother Thomas Duca and his parents Mr. & Mrs. Anthony Duca.
